4 Years Ago Pennsylvania churchgoers bring AR-15 rifles, wear bullet crowns to commitment ceremony

"Hundreds of parishioners flocked to a Pennsylvania church to exchange or renew wedding vows, while carrying AR-15 rifles. The World Peace Unification Sanctuary in Newfoundland included a blessing for the assault rifle, which it believes symbolizes the “rod of iron” in the book of Revelation."
